    Setting Your Budget

    Before you start your search for houses for rent in San Antonio, TX, it's essential to determine your budget. As a general rule, experts recommend spending no more than 30% of your gross monthly income on rent. This will help ensure that you have enough money left over for other essential expenses, such as utilities, transportation, food, and healthcare. Keep in mind that rent is not the only cost associated with renting a house. You'll also need to factor in expenses such as security deposit, application fees, pet fees (if applicable), and renter's insurance. It's also a good idea to set aside some money for unexpected expenses that may arise during your tenancy, such as repairs or maintenance issues. Once you have a clear understanding of your budget, you can narrow down your search to houses that are within your price range.

    Utilizing Online Resources

    The internet is your best friend when it comes to finding houses for rent in San Antonio, TX. Websites like Zillow, Apartments.com, Trulia, and Realtor.com are excellent resources for browsing listings and filtering your search based on your specific criteria. You can filter by price, location, number of bedrooms and bathrooms, amenities, and pet-friendliness. These websites also provide valuable information about each property, such as photos, virtual tours, and neighborhood demographics. Be sure to read the listing descriptions carefully and pay attention to any red flags, such as unusually low rent or vague descriptions. It's also a good idea to check online reviews of landlords and property management companies to get a sense of their reputation. In addition to the major rental websites, you can also find listings on Craigslist and Facebook Marketplace. However, be cautious when using these platforms and be wary of scams. Never send money to someone you haven't met in person, and always verify the identity of the landlord or property manager before signing a lease.

    Tips for a Smooth Rental Process

    Finding houses for rent in San Antonio, TX doesn't have to be stressful. Here are some tips to make the process easier:

    • Prepare your documents: Landlords will typically require you to provide proof of income, credit history, and references. Gather these documents ahead of time to expedite the application process.
    • Be ready to act fast: The rental market in San Antonio can be competitive, so be prepared to make a decision quickly when you find a house you like.
    • Read the lease carefully: Before signing a lease, read it thoroughly and make sure you understand all the terms and conditions. Pay attention to details such as rent payment schedule, security deposit requirements, and pet policies.
    • Take photos of the property: Before moving in, take photos of the property to document its condition. This will protect you from being held responsible for pre-existing damage when you move out.

    Popular Neighborhoods for Renters

    Let's dive into some popular neighborhoods where you can find awesome houses for rent in San Antonio, TX:

    • Alamo Heights: Known for its excellent schools and upscale homes, Alamo Heights is a great option for families.
    • Stone Oak: This master-planned community offers a variety of housing options and convenient access to shopping and dining.
    • The Pearl District: A trendy urban neighborhood with a vibrant culinary scene and unique shops.
    • Downtown San Antonio: Perfect for those who want to be in the heart of the action, with easy access to attractions and entertainment.
    • Medical Center: A convenient location for healthcare professionals and students, with a variety of affordable housing options.
